<center lang="7oizew"></center><del lang="z0lqfq"></del><b lang="kcjo_m"></b><ol dir="xy4c4k"></ol><map lang="fsjhlh"></map><i id="kiv5tl"></i><del lang="9geq65"></del><em dir="fy61hz"></em><center dropzone="kpa1m8"></center><sub dir="2uk6_i"></sub><time draggable="fas0jl"></time><ul id="2h3zqd"></ul><time dropzone="hijk9c"></time><font dropzone="p796tl"></font><i lang="bndw06"></i><i lang="efl41z"></i><map dir="q2x6y2"></map><ins date-time="syvviy"></ins><i draggable="6l0oz7"></i><del date-time="msq68h"></del><b draggable="4xr72n"></b><bdo dir="sty3ak"></bdo><ul date-time="b699rq"></ul><code draggable="w1_h9x"></code><acronym lang="7cpsu_"></acronym><ul dropzone="objb1j"></ul><i lang="ntarwf"></i><i dir="pyjcxh"></i><ol date-time="_sy53d"></ol><em dir="4idlc5"></em><var dir="e6qzy2"></var><em dir="iyowiw"></em><strong lang="hh2cui"></strong><bdo date-time="t3j3xm"></bdo><code date-time="1km9kw"></code><dfn id="x9t1oa"></dfn><acronym draggable="ucab1m"></acronym><dfn date-time="e8hp_6"></dfn><strong dir="84ex4o"></strong><var date-time="jnde_y"></var><legend id="xc1tdl"></legend><code date-time="v0jwk2"></code><center lang="qx5vib"></center><abbr draggable="tfl5rh"></abbr><small dir="e_6vz0"></small><b dropzone="4pt281"></b><abbr lang="ifri1w"></abbr><address lang="dxa_ek"></address><del dropzone="ss8lxe"></del><var date-time="zdm6gr"></var>

            全面解析比特币钱包地址与secp256k1加密算法

            时间:2026-02-11 04:01:42

            主页 > 加密圈 >

                          ### 内容主体大纲 1. 引言 - 比特币简介 - 钱包的作用 - secp256k1算法综述 2. 比特币钱包地址的结构 - 钱包地址的定义 - 地址的类型(P2PKH、P2SH等) - 地址的生成过程 3. secp256k1加密算法详解 - 什么是secp256k1? - 背景与发展 - 主要特点与优势 4. secp256k1在比特币中的应用 - 秘钥生成 - 签名与验证过程 - 安全性分析 5. 比特币交易基本流程 - 发起交易的步骤 - 钱包地址在交易中的角色 - 区块链记录与确认 6. 常见的比特币钱包类型 - 热钱包与冷钱包 - 硬件钱包推荐 - 软件钱包的优缺点 7. 安全性与风险管理 - 如何保护你的比特币钱包 - 常见的安全威胁与防范 - 备份与恢复策略 8. 总结与展望 - 比特币的未来 - secp256k1在其他领域的应用潜力 - 用户应如何适应变革 --- ## 1. 引言 在数字货币的浪潮中,比特币作为第一个,也是最为知名的加密货币,已成为人们关注的焦点。其中,比特币钱包的作用不可小觑,它不仅是存储比特币的地方,更是用户与比特币网络交互的桥梁。而支撑这一切的背后,secp256k1加密算法则是确保交易安全及隐私保护的重要技术。 比特币的诞生源于对传统金融体系的不信任,它基于区块链技术,使用加密算法来确保交易的安全性与不可篡改性。本文将深入探讨比特币钱包地址的构造,以及secp256k1算法在比特币生态中的核心作用。 ## 2. 比特币钱包地址的结构 ### 钱包地址的定义 比特币钱包地址是一个字符串,通常由字母和数字组成,用于标识一个比特币账户。用户通过这个地址来进行比特币的接收和发送,宛如传统银行账户的编号。 ### 地址的类型(P2PKH、P2SH等) 比特币地址有几种不同的类型,最常见的包括Pay-to-Public-Key-Hash(P2PKH)和Pay-to-Script-Hash(P2SH)等。P2PKH地址以数字"1"开头,而P2SH地址通常以数字"3"开头。每种地址类型在功能和使用上都有其独特之处。 ### 地址的生成过程 生成比特币地址的过程相对复杂,需要经历多个步骤。首先,用户生成一个私钥,之后利用secp256k1算法从私钥生成公钥,最后通过哈希算法将公钥转化为比特币地址。这个过程不仅要保证生成过程的安全性,还要确保最终地址的唯一性与有效性。 ## 3. secp256k1加密算法详解 ### 什么是secp256k1? secp256k1是一种椭圆曲线数字签名算法(ECDSA),它在比特币的安全生态中发挥着关键作用。该算法基于椭圆曲线数学原理,提供高安全性且运算效率相对较高的数字签名解决方案。 ### 背景与发展 secp256k1最初由Stanford大学的研究团队开发,目的是为了在金融领域提供强大的加密支持。随着比特币的兴起,该算法的应用逐渐得到普及,并成为比特币及其生态系统中的核心技术。 ### 主要特点与优势 secp256k1的主要特点之一是其安全性。使用256位密钥的设定,使得破解这一算法的难度大大增加。此外,算法的计算效率较高,能够在资源有限的设备上快速完成签名和验证工作。 ## 4. secp256k1在比特币中的应用 ### 秘钥生成 用户在创建比特币钱包时,首先需要生成一对公钥和私钥。而secp256k1正是用于这一生成过程的核心算法。私钥的保密程度直接关系到用户比特币的安全性,因此理解这一点至关重要。 ### 签名与验证过程 在进行比特币交易时,发送者需对交易进行签名,以证明其拥有相应的比特币。这一过程实质上是通过secp256k1算法生成数字签名,接收者可通过发送者的公钥对签名进行验证,从而确认交易的真实性。 ### 安全性分析 secp256k1的安全性不仅依赖于其复杂的数学结构,还有广泛的应用和研究。尽管如此,用户仍需注意私钥的保护,不应将其泄露,以免遭到黑客攻击。 ## 5. 比特币交易基本流程 ### 发起交易的步骤 用户在发起比特币交易时,需要首先输入接收方的地址及转账金额,然后通过自己的钱包进行确认。接着,交易信息被打包并发送到比特币网络中,等待被矿工确认。 ### 钱包地址在交易中的角色 在整个过程中,钱包地址是确保资金流动的关键。它不仅用于标识交易参与者,还在确认交易时提供必要的公钥信息。 ### 区块链记录与确认 一旦矿工确认交易,将其添加到区块链中,该笔交易便被视为有效,无法再次进行更改。因此,区块链的不可篡改性与透明性为比特币交易提供了额外的保障。 ## 6. 常见的比特币钱包类型 ### 热钱包与冷钱包 比特币钱包主要分为热钱包与冷钱包。热钱包是指在线钱包,方便快捷,但相对风险较高;而冷钱包则为离线钱包,更加安全,但使用上较为不便。 ### 硬件钱包推荐 对于需要高安全性的用户,硬件钱包是一个不错的选择。市面上有多款优秀的硬件钱包,如Ledger和Trezor等,可以有效保护用户的私钥免受网络攻击。 ### 软件钱包的优缺点 软件钱包则是以应用程序的形式存在,用户可以方便地进行比特币的日常交易。尽管使用方便,但若软件未及时更新或来自不明来源,安全性则会受到威胁。 ## 7. 安全性与风险管理 ### 如何保护你的比特币钱包 进行比特币投资时,保护钱包的安全非常重要。用户应采用多重身份验证、强密码保护及定期备份等安全措施,确保私钥的安全。 ### 常见的安全威胁与防范 网络钓鱼、木马病毒等安全威胁时常出现在加密货币用户的网络环境中。了解这些威胁,并采取积极的防范措施,有助于用户的比特币资产安全。 ### 备份与恢复策略 比特币钱包的备份与恢复同样重要。用户应定期备份钱包文件,并将其安全存储在离线环境中,以便在设备损坏或丢失时能够顺利恢复。 ## 8. 总结与展望 比特币的未来充满希望,随着技术的不断演进,更多的应用场景将被开发。而secp256k1算法不仅在比特币中发挥着至关重要的作用,也有潜力在其他领域得到广泛应用,推动加密技术的进一步发展。用户在享受数字货币带来的便利时,务必要提高警惕,采取适当的安全策略,以保护自己的资产安全。 ### 7个相关问题及详细介绍 ####

                          1. 比特币钱包如何工作?

                          比特币钱包的工作机制主要依赖于公私钥对和区块链技术。用户通过生成一对密钥——公钥和私钥,来实现比特币的接收和发送。公钥其实就是比特币地址的生成源...

                          ####

                          2. 为什么要选择secp256k1进行比特币交易?

                          secp256k1是一种高效安全的算法,采用256位密钥,保障了比特币交易的安全性。从比特币的诞生之初,就选择了这一加密方式,最大限度降低了被攻击的风险...

                          ####

                          3. 如何安全存储比特币?

                          存储比特币的安全措施至关重要。用户可以采取冷存储、热钱包相结合的方式来降低风险。同时,使用硬件钱包也成为许多用户的首选...

                          ####

                          4. 比特币地址是否可以随意共享?

                          比特币地址是可以共享的,但要注意不要公开自己的私钥。虽然地址本身是安全的,但私钥的泄露可能导致资金的损失...

                          ####

                          5. 什么是硬件钱包?其优缺点是什么?

                          硬件钱包是一种离线存储比特币的设备,能够有效防止在线攻击。其优点是安全性高,但缺点是价格相对较贵,使用时稍显不便...

                          ####

                          6. 什么是数字签名,它的重要性是什么?

                          数字签名主要用于确保交易的真实性和不可篡改性。通过secp256k1算法生成的签名,可以让接收方确认交易确实是由持有私钥的一方发起的...

                          ####

                          7. 如何进行比特币的交易确认?

                          比特币的交易通过矿工的挖矿活动进行确认。每笔交易在成功打包到区块中后,便得到了一次确认。在交易被确认之前,交易状态为“待确认”...

                          --- 以上内容对比特币钱包地址及secp256k1加密算法进行了全面阐述,涵盖了基本概念、应用、安全性等多个方面,希望可以帮助用户更深入地了解比特币及其生态。